Zanzibar airport upgrades attract global airlines
ZANZIBAR: THE Zanzibar government has attributed the growing interest from major international airlines to improved infrastructure and enhanced safety standards at Abeid Amani Karume International Airport (AAKIA). The latest development follows the launch of Airlink’s direct flights between South Africa and Zanzibar, further strengthening the islands’ position as a regional tourism and business hub.
